Output 1c8d328828b268bbc14fa369a070f537dd95ac57f38471f101cccfb848114504:1

value
18950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354dbe6448ea80df538b409c32263fae92af268a OP_EQUAL
address
36YrsSQxQioFxjhQD63cv8hyNwUVnTbApQ
transaction
1c8d328828b268bbc14fa369a070f537dd95ac57f38471f101cccfb848114504
spent
true